Cuthona albocrusta (MacFarland, 1966)              
White-crusted Cuthona
Mollusca: Gastropoda: Opisthobranchia: Nudibranchia: Aeolidina: Tergipedidae
Geographic Range: Prince William Sound, AK, to La Paz, Baja California, Mexico Synonyms: Trinchesia albocrusta

Description: Ground color greyish-white, dorsum encrusted with opaque white extending from head to posterior row of cerata, from there postero-medially, as a broken line, to tail. Irregular spots of opaque white are scattered on sides of body. Cerata encrusted with opaque white on distal two thirds, leaving tips free, cores vary from pale or deep green to pale or deep raw umber. Oral tentacles with a few scattered flecks of opaque white. Rhinophores smooth, bearing various amount of encrusting white distally. Anterior foot corners rounded.
Size: Typically less than 8mm in length.
